    NNPC insists Port Harcourt refinery up, running

    The Nigerian National Petroleum Company Limited (NNPCL) has insisted that the Old Port Harcourt Refinery is up and running, with loading operations in full swing.

    The Group Chief Executive Officer, Mr Mele Kyari, gave the confirmation at the commissioning of the NUPENG Towers in Lagos on Wednesday, according to a statement signed by the Chief Corporate Communications Officer NNPC Ltd, Olufemi Soneye.

    There has been serious contention over the operation of the newly rehabilitated refinery after its much-celebrated commencement of production.

    The Nigerian National Petroleum Company Limited (NNPCL) said the plant, operating at 70 per cent capacity, will deliver 200 trucks daily. Currently, only trucks belonging to the national oil firm are picking products from the facility.

    But in a goodwill message at the event, Kyari extended an invitation to human rights activist and lawyer Mr Femi Falana and all those in doubt to join the NNPC Ltd. on a tour of the refineries in Port Harcourt, Warri, and Kaduna to verify their status.

    He also shed light on the controversy around product blending, stating that blending was not a crime as it is an integral part of the refining process.

    “If you don’t blend, you will bring out off-spec products, which will destroy your vehicles. Every refinery blends because what is on the specification in the United States of America will be off-spec in Nigeria and elsewhere. Blending is necessary to bring products to the specification of different countries or regions,” he explained.

    Kyari also congratulated NUPENG on the successful completion of the NUPENG Towers and urged the union to continue to prioritise dialogue in its relationship with NNPC Ltd and the Federal Government.
